Ngin cache初体验 前言大家都知道cache对于网站性能的重要性,提高用户响应速度,减轻后端压力,节省资源等等。一谈到cache其实是个很大话题,从前端浏览器到最终响应请求的服务器可能要经过很多次跳转,每次跳转经过的服务器都有机会提供cache。单从成本上而言
全站缓存时代 原则:动静分离,分级缓存,主动失效。Web 开发中,接口会被分为以下几类:纯静态页面。打死我都不会修改的页面。很长一段时间内,基本上不会修改。比如:关于我们。纯动态页面。实时性,个性化要求比较高。页面变化很大,或者每个用户看到的都不一样,比
动静分离的数据并发加载策略 作者:莫冠钊转载请注明出处,保留原文链接和作者信息前言当今许多大型网页应用尤其是SPA均采用了动静分离的策略。关于动静分离的描述,这里推荐一篇不错的博文 网站静态化处理—动静分离策略。本人是做前端的,之前有幸与一位对性能追求极致的后端同学一
性能优化详解 几个月前面试的时候问我性能优化我可能会开始背诵雅虎军规,加点webp,代码层面稍稍讲点,现在系统的梳理下性能优化的方方面面本文涉及方面有:代码优化网络请求过程角度入手DNS解析TCP建立链接网络往返时延(RTT)数据传输网络问题角度入手请求
Magi.Cache介绍 转载请注明出处:https://github.com/thx/magix/...在前端开发过程中,我们经常会在内存中缓存一些数据,其实javascript的缓存比较简单,只需要声明一个变量或把一些数据挂到某个对象上即可,比如我们要实现一个对
Android干货框架集锦,搭建项目必不可少 在开发过程中使用过很多优秀框架,比如网络的okhttp,图片的Fresco,注入的Gagger2等,都是非常优秀的框架。所以今天在此介绍下至今本人知道的一些比较流行主流且很优秀的框架。根据上图我们依次说明:DiskLruCache硬盘缓存最
58沈剑用3个小时的视频告诉你高可用的那些事儿 本文是58到家技术总监沈剑在MPD2016 北京站上的演讲视频。全面解析单点系统的可用性架构与优化/消息系统的可达性架构与优化/事务系统的一致性架构与优化。 1.互联网单点系统可用性架构与优化: 点击此处观看视频。时长63分钟,建议收藏和转
如何从程序开发角度做产品的用户体验? 本篇文章从缓存、加载、数据上传三个方面阐述如何如何从程序开发角度做产品的用户体验(针对App)。用户体验指的是用户在使用产品、服务、系统时的主观感受。其中主观感受就是用户在使用产品、服务、系统时的感触、意识和情绪。所以好的用户体验涉及到整个